2/6 Boadle Rd, Bundoora is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2010. The property has a land size of 114m2 and floor size of 121m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2024.

The size of Bundoora is approximately 17.3 square kilometres. It has 85 parks covering nearly 31.6% of total area. The population of Bundoora in 2016 was 28653 people. By 2021 the population was 28068 showing a population decline of 2.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bundoora is 20-29 years. Households in Bundoora are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bundoora work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 68.80% of the homes in Bundoora were owner-occupied compared with 68.90% in 2016.
